Product reviews:
Vtech - Toot-Toot Animals Animal Boat vtech toot toot animal boat
vtech toot toot animal boat
Perry
2025-10-22 iphone XS Max
Vtech 500303 \ vtech toot toot animal boat
vtech toot toot animal boat
Roy
2025-10-20 iphone 7 Plus
Toot-Toot Animals Animal Boat vtech toot toot animal boat
vtech toot toot animal boat